N-Arachidonoyl-L-serine is an endocannabinoid that primarily targets Akt to induce phosphorylation in endothelial cells. It facilitates endothelium-dependent vasodilation in isolated rat mesenteric and abdominal aortas. Additionally, N-Arachidonoyl-L-serine demonstrates neuroprotective effects following traumatic brain injury by reducing apoptosis. It also promotes the opening of KV7.1/KCNE1 channels in mammalian cells, shortening action potential duration in cardiomyocytes. This compound is valuable for research in cardiovascular, cerebrovascular, and neurological disorders.
